Union Minister Dr Jitendra Singh interacted with IAS officer trainees of the 2024 batch and hailed the nearly 41 percent representation of women officers, one of the highest in IAS history.
Addressing the trainees during the Assistant Secretary Programme at CSOI, New Delhi, the Minister said the changing profile of India’s Civil Services reflects a more aspirational, technology-driven and inclusive India.
He said the present generation of officers would play a key role in shaping India’s governance as the country approaches 100 years of Independence in 2047.
The Minister highlighted the importance of technology, digital governance, Artificial Intelligence and continuous learning in modern administration. He urged the young officers to remain citizen-centric, transparent and committed to ethical public service.
A total of 184 IAS officers of the 2024 batch are currently attached with 49 Ministries and Departments under the eight-week Assistant Secretary Programme.
